NZCVS Cycle 4 (2020-21), March 2023
Controlling behaviours and help-seeking for Family Violence. This report is based on the NZCVS Cycle 4 (2020/21) data. The report covers New Zealand adults' experiences of controlling behaviours and harm in the context of a close personal relationship (current and previous partners, and other family or whānau members) and their help-seeking behaviours. The questions relating to controlling behaviour were introduced in Cycle 4 of the NZCVS and have been designed to capture the broader patterns of family violence as it is defined in the Family Violence Act 2018.
